Nutrients Stop Cognitive Decline

Thursday, February 12, 2009  -  Byron Richards, CCN

Researchers at the University of Massachusetts1 have demonstrated that a mixture of fine quality dietary supplements (ALC, DHA Docosahexaenoic acid Essential omega 3 fatty acid integral to the health of all cell membranes, nerve and brain function. Must be gotten through the diet via cold water oceanic fish or some very limited plant sources or taken as a supplement., PS, and Lipoic Acid) can stop oxidative damage in the brains of animals, the type of damage that otherwise leads to cognitive decline and Alzheimer’s. 

During the experiment mice were exposed to a diet that promotes free radical damage, which typically causes cognitive decline.  The group of mice receiving quality brain nutrition, rich in antioxidants, experienced no cognitive decline from the diet.

The researchers concluded by saying, “These findings add to the growing body of research indicating that key dietary supplementation may delay the progression of age-related cognitive decline.”
